新聞中心
Access數(shù)據(jù)庫是一種常見的關(guān)系型數(shù)據(jù)庫管理軟件,適用于各種類型和大小的企業(yè)和個(gè)人實(shí)現(xiàn)數(shù)據(jù)的管理、存儲(chǔ)和分析。當(dāng)我們意外丟失了Access數(shù)據(jù)庫文件中的數(shù)據(jù),或者想要恢復(fù)以前某個(gè)時(shí)間點(diǎn)上的數(shù)據(jù)結(jié)果,備份可謂是一種非常好的解決方案。然而,在備份文件中找到需要恢復(fù)的數(shù)據(jù)并打開時(shí),有時(shí)會(huì)遇到某些困難。下面將介紹幾種打開備份的Access數(shù)據(jù)庫文件的方法。

專注于為中小企業(yè)提供成都網(wǎng)站建設(shè)、網(wǎng)站建設(shè)服務(wù),電腦端+手機(jī)端+微信端的三站合一,更高效的管理,為中小企業(yè)江陰免費(fèi)做網(wǎng)站提供優(yōu)質(zhì)的服務(wù)。我們立足成都,凝聚了一批互聯(lián)網(wǎng)行業(yè)人才,有力地推動(dòng)了超過千家企業(yè)的穩(wěn)健成長,幫助中小企業(yè)通過網(wǎng)站建設(shè)實(shí)現(xiàn)規(guī)模擴(kuò)充和轉(zhuǎn)變。
一、使用Access應(yīng)用程序打開(.mdb/.accdb)文件
Access軟件自帶了“打開文件”功能,我們可以通過這個(gè)功能很方便地打開備份的Access數(shù)據(jù)庫文件。打開Access 2023應(yīng)用程序,選擇“打開其他文件”選項(xiàng),在彈出的窗口中選擇需要打開的文件。Access會(huì)提示用戶使用什么方式打開文件,我們可以選擇“只讀”、“設(shè)計(jì)模式”或“正?!辈僮髂J健T谶@里我們選擇“正常模式”,然后輸入數(shù)據(jù)庫密碼(如果有),即可打開數(shù)據(jù)文件。
二、使用Microsoft Access Database Engine打開文件
如果你沒有安裝Access軟件,或者使用的是早期版本的Access數(shù)據(jù)庫,那么可以使用Microsoft Access Database Engine打開備份的Access數(shù)據(jù)庫文件。我們可以前往Microsoft官網(wǎng)下載和安裝Microsoft Access Database Engine組件,然后使用這個(gè)組件打開文件。在Windows資源管理器中找到需要打開的數(shù)據(jù)庫文件,右鍵單擊該文件并選擇“屬性”,然后在“常規(guī)”選項(xiàng)卡中,點(diǎn)擊“更改”按鈕。在打開的窗口中,選擇Microsoft Access數(shù)據(jù)庫引擎,然后點(diǎn)擊“確定”按鈕。這樣就可以打開數(shù)據(jù)庫文件了。
三、使用代碼打開(VBA)文件
如果用戶熟悉Visual Basic for Applications(VBA)編程語言,也可以使用代碼直接打開備份的Access數(shù)據(jù)庫文件。使用代碼可以靈活地對備份文件進(jìn)行處理,適用于更復(fù)雜和高級的操作案例。啟動(dòng)Microsoft Access軟件,然后選擇“模塊”選項(xiàng)卡,在模塊視圖中選擇“新建模塊”,并在彈出窗口中輸入以下代碼:
Sub OpenAccessFile()
Dim accApp As Access.Application
Set accApp = New Access.Application
accApp.OpenCurrentDatabase (“文件路徑\文件名.accdb”)
accApp.DoCmd.CloseDatabase
Set accApp = Nothing
End Sub
用戶需要替換代碼中的“文件路徑”和“文件名”為實(shí)際的備份文件路徑和名稱。然后,按下運(yùn)行模塊按鈕,在彈出的窗口中選擇函數(shù)“OpenAccessFile”并點(diǎn)擊“運(yùn)行”按鈕。通過這種方式,用戶可以打開指定的備份文件,進(jìn)行數(shù)據(jù)的處理及恢復(fù)操作。
備份是每個(gè)Access數(shù)據(jù)庫用戶必須進(jìn)行的重要工作,確保我們的數(shù)據(jù)不會(huì)在不慎刪除或者系統(tǒng)故障的情況下丟失。當(dāng)然,對于備份數(shù)據(jù)文件的打開及恢復(fù)也是我們不可忽視的工作。上述方法提供了多種方案,用戶可以選擇最適合自己的方法來打開備份數(shù)據(jù)文件,并恢復(fù)我們寶貴的數(shù)據(jù)。
相關(guān)問題拓展閱讀:
- 如何打開Access數(shù)據(jù)庫
- 如何備份access數(shù)據(jù)庫,為什么提示錯(cuò)誤
如何打開Access數(shù)據(jù)庫
vb 本身就有
OpenDatabase 函鋒讓茄數(shù)
樓上的傻滑野啊
只是打開 何苦引用vba
調(diào)excel阿
(可能需要引用ado
在工程–引用里)
用datagrid
dim db as database
dim rs as recordset
db=opendatabase(“user id=;password=;data source=d:\銀察a.mdb”)
rs=db.OpenRecordSet( “Table1”,dbOpenSnapshot)
datagrid1.datasouce=rs
datagrid1.bind
Visual Basic對Access數(shù)據(jù)庫的集成非常緊密,通常由以下幾個(gè)櫻茄部分組成。
引用DAO類型庫
1、從“工程”菜單中選擇“引用”菜單項(xiàng);
2、在可引用列表框中選擇“Microsoft DAO 3.51 Object Library”項(xiàng)。
3、最后“確定”即可
設(shè)置DAO數(shù)據(jù)類型變量
DAO數(shù)據(jù)類型變量共分成兩種:
1、Database變量
對應(yīng)于Access數(shù)據(jù)庫,通常在模塊中被定義為Public全程變量:
Public AccessDBF As Database
’定義數(shù)據(jù)庫對象實(shí)例AccessDBF
2、RecordSet變量
對應(yīng)于Access數(shù)據(jù)庫中的一個(gè)表,可定喚頌鉛義為全程變量或局部變量,亦可作為函數(shù)參數(shù)進(jìn)行傳遞:
Dim thePrintTable As RecordSet
’定義一個(gè)表對象實(shí)例thePrintTable
打開DAO數(shù)據(jù)類型
1、打開Access的方法
通??稍O(shè)置一個(gè)專門的Public函數(shù)用來打開一個(gè)Access數(shù)據(jù)庫,并且該函數(shù)在啟動(dòng)窗體的Private Sub Form_load ( )過程中被調(diào)用,函數(shù)定義格式如下:
Public Sub OpenDatabase ( )
Dim sConeect As String
SConnect = “;PWD =; UID = admin ”
’設(shè)置打開時(shí)的用戶名、口令等參數(shù)
Set AccessDBF = Nothing
’確認(rèn)關(guān)閉對象實(shí)例
Set AccessDBF = WorksPaces (0 ).OpenDatabase (App.Path&&”/ToXls.MDB”,False,sConnect)
’打開當(dāng)前路徑的ToXls.MDB數(shù)據(jù)庫
End Sub
2、打開RecordSet的方法
RecordSet遵循即用即開的原則,所以它通常在函數(shù)中打開
Set thePrintTable = AcessDBF.OpenRecordSet ( “Table_1”,dbOpenSnapshot )
相關(guān)的數(shù)據(jù)操作
數(shù)據(jù)實(shí)際需要對Access表中的記錄、字段、數(shù)據(jù)項(xiàng)進(jìn)行操作。下列雙重循環(huán)把數(shù)據(jù)輸出到Excel對應(yīng)的單元和好格中:
For j = 0 To 2
For I = 0 To 3
ThePrintTable.MoveNext
Excel.Sheet.Range ( Trim ( chr ( 71+j*10+I ) )+”G”).Value = thePrintTable.Fields (0)
Next I
Next j
關(guān)閉數(shù)據(jù)庫
1、關(guān)閉Database
它通常在整個(gè)應(yīng)用程序的最后進(jìn)行操作,即通常出現(xiàn)在Private Sub Form_unload (Cannel As Interger )過程中。命令格式實(shí)例如下:
AccessDBF.Close
2、關(guān)閉RecordSet
DAO好像打不開ACCESS2023版本的激塵梁數(shù)據(jù)庫, 如果是ACCESS2023請轉(zhuǎn)換為ACCESS97版本的數(shù)據(jù)兄賣庫, 用ACCESS自帶的工具就可以明運(yùn)轉(zhuǎn)換.要想打開ACCESS2023更好用ADO或引用ADODC控件
1.安洞漏鄭裝OFFICE 2023.
2.將搜枝后綴為ASP的ACCESS數(shù)據(jù)庫文件改后綴納頌為:mdb
3.打開.
在工具里先建個(gè)ado控件啊…然后設(shè)置屬性就可以拉
如何備份access數(shù)據(jù)庫,為什么提示錯(cuò)誤
1、備份后端數(shù)據(jù)庫
啟動(dòng) Access,但不要打開數(shù)據(jù)庫。
單擊“Office 按鈕”,然后單擊“打開”。
在“打開”對話框中,選擇后端數(shù)據(jù)庫文件。如果需要瀏覽才能找到該數(shù)據(jù)庫文件,則可以使用“查找范圍”列表。
單擊“打開”按鈕上的箭頭,然后單擊“以獨(dú)占方式打開”。
單擊“Office 按鈕”,指向“譽(yù)早管理”,然后在“管理此數(shù)據(jù)庫”下單擊“備份數(shù)據(jù)庫”。
在“另存為”對話框中的“文件名”框中,查看數(shù)據(jù)庫備份的默認(rèn)名稱。
在“另存為”對話框中,選擇要保存數(shù)據(jù)庫備份的位置,然后單擊“保存”。
2、備份前端數(shù)據(jù)庫
單擊“打開”按鈕上的箭頭,然后單擊“以獨(dú)占方式打開”。
單擊“Office 按鈕”,指向“櫻缺管理”,脊虛辯然后在“管理此數(shù)據(jù)庫”下單擊“備份數(shù)據(jù)庫”。
在“另存為”對話框中的“文件名”框中,查看數(shù)據(jù)庫備份的默認(rèn)名稱。
在“另存為”對話框中,選擇要保存數(shù)據(jù)庫備份的位置,然后單擊“保存”。
備份access數(shù)據(jù)庫文件怎么打開的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于備份access數(shù)據(jù)庫文件怎么打開,如何打開備份的Access數(shù)據(jù)庫文件?,如何打開Access數(shù)據(jù)庫,如何備份access數(shù)據(jù)庫,為什么提示錯(cuò)誤的信息別忘了在本站進(jìn)行查找喔。
創(chuàng)新互聯(lián)成都網(wǎng)站建設(shè)公司提供專業(yè)的建站服務(wù),為您量身定制,歡迎來電(028-86922220)為您打造專屬于企業(yè)本身的網(wǎng)絡(luò)品牌形象。
成都創(chuàng)新互聯(lián)品牌官網(wǎng)提供專業(yè)的網(wǎng)站建設(shè)、設(shè)計(jì)、制作等服務(wù),是一家以網(wǎng)站建設(shè)為主要業(yè)務(wù)的公司,在網(wǎng)站建設(shè)、設(shè)計(jì)和制作領(lǐng)域具有豐富的經(jīng)驗(yàn)。
新聞名稱:如何打開備份的Access數(shù)據(jù)庫文件?(備份access數(shù)據(jù)庫文件怎么打開)
本文地址:http://fisionsoft.com.cn/article/cohcoip.html


咨詢
建站咨詢
